With AMD vs Nvidia, both have new technology architectures and harping on these for consumers to purchase their products. In this case it is narrowed down to ATi (DX10.1 and Tesselator) and Nvidia (PhysX and CUDA).
So my question is which of these would be best for current games AS WELL AS be best FUTURE PROOF, DX10.1 or PhysX?
Is it true that developers are moving more towards computational developing which will therefore make PhysX more future proof?
